stm32 hal库 st7789 1.54寸lcd

文章目录

  • 前言
  • 一、软件spi
    • 1.cubemx配置
    • 2.源码文件
  • 二、硬件spi
    • 1.cubemx配置
    • 2.源码文件
    • 3.小小修改
  • 总结


前言

1.54寸lcd 240*240


一、软件spi

1.cubemx配置

一定要注意把这几个东西上拉。
使用c8
stm32 hal库 st7789 1.54寸lcd_第1张图片

2.源码文件

我使用的是中景园的源码,他本来是是标准库的稍微修改一下就行了。
以下是我修改后的
https://gitee.com/linsen06/stm32_st7789lcd

二、硬件spi

文件

1.cubemx配置

一定要注意把这几个东西上拉。
使用c8t6
stm32 hal库 st7789 1.54寸lcd_第2张图片
stm32 hal库 st7789 1.54寸lcd_第3张图片

2.源码文件

只需要修改一个地方就行

stm32 hal库 st7789 1.54寸lcd_第4张图片
https://gitee.com/linsen06/stm32_st7789lcd

3.小小修改

这里可以选择
当不需要硬件spi的时候就可以把那句define注释掉,
user_lcd_spi 可以选使用哪个spi
stm32 hal库 st7789 1.54寸lcd_第5张图片

总结

stm32 hal库 st7789 1.54寸lcd_第6张图片

你可能感兴趣的:(stm32,嵌入式硬件,单片机)